My organization is holding a fundraiser. Can the Art Gallery of Hamilton donate money or a work of art?

0

The Art Gallery of Hamilton (AGH) is solicited daily for gifts of cash, objects and services. We recognize that there are many worthwhile organizations and individuals doing good work in our community. The AGH is itself a registered charity; as such, we are bound by the Canadian Revenue Agency conditions regulating charitable organizations. The Gallery carries out its own charitable activities. These activities are conducted under our direction and control, and carried out by our employees and volunteers. CRA regulations are very clear as to allowable activities for charitable organizations regarding gifts of any kind to organizations and/or individuals. We cannot provide other organizations or individuals with financial support (whether cash, goods or services, including, for example, cash sponsorships; instructors and art supplies for events; and objects from the Shop at AGH or permanent collection).
